  What is a PhD in Business Management?

A PhD in Business Management is an academic doctorate that emphasizes scientific research and the creation of new knowledge in the field of management.

  • Develops critical thinking and strategic analysis skills.
  • Focuses on theoretical studies and research methodologies.
  • Prepares students for academic teaching and research roles.

Objectives of a PhD in Business Management

The main goal of a PhD in Business Management is to equip students with deep knowledge and research skills needed to lead complex research projects.

  • Strengthen the ability to design and conduct advanced research.
  • Develop academic writing and publication skills.
  • Build a strong knowledge base in management sciences.

Duration of a PhD in Business Management

The duration of a PhD in Business Management varies by institution but typically ranges from 3 to 5 years.

  • The first year often includes foundational courses and literature review.
  • The following years focus on conducting research and writing the dissertation.
  • Requires full commitment and intensive work to complete successfully.

Curriculum of a PhD in Business Management

The PhD in Business Management curriculum combines advanced theoretical knowledge with research methodologies.

  • Advanced studies in strategic management, finance, and marketing.
  • Quantitative and qualitative research methods.
  • Development of critical analysis and dissertation writing skills.

What is a DBA?

The Doctor of Business Administration (DBA) is a professional doctorate designed for experienced business professionals who want to apply advanced research to real-world organizational challenges. 

Unlike a PhD, which emphasizes theoretical research, the DBA focuses on practical solutions and strategic decision-making.

  • Combines academic rigor with practical business application.
  • Ideal for executives, managers, and consultants.
  • Focuses on improving business processes, strategy, and performance.

PhD in Business Management vs DBA

Although both are doctoral-level programs, a PhD in Business Management differs significantly from a DBA.

  • PhD focuses on theoretical research and advancing academic knowledge.
  • DBA emphasizes practical applications and solving real-world business problems.
  • The duration of a PhD in Business Management is usually longer due to intensive research requirements.
